Summary: We were unable to take the trip, but 3 stars because we got some of our money back, however the company's aggressive posture and predatory no-refund policy were off-putting.
We booked with Camino Ways (CW) in mid-February of 2025 with plans to travel with them on the Camino in late May of 2025. We were disappointed to see that, like the other tour operators on the Camino, CW only offered non-refundable trips if you are forced to cancel for any reason less than 30 days before your trip (more on this later).
Unfortunately, I was diagnosed with a medical condition that prevented travel just a day before our flight to Spain. Although we booked nonrefundable flights with both United and Iberia, both airlines extended us full 100% credit for later travel.
However, just like the hyper-aggressive and corporate AirBnB, Camino Ways, held firm with their policy, telling us we should rely on trip insurance (turns out that our trip insurance did not cover tours) and told us we couldn't get anything back but that we could substitute a family member in our place (?!).
Ultimately, after more haggling with them, CW did issue a partial credit (no refund) for use in the next 24 months. Not sure we can use that, but it seemed like the best we could get from them, sadly.
Finally, we were also reminded that "all of the other tour operators on the Camino have the same policy" when it comes to nonrefundable trips....this was said as if it were some kind of moral or ethical defense of CW's policy! Of course, this is no such thing, this is merely collusion between a limited number of operators to take advantage of Pilgrims and tourists wanting help planning a trip on the Camino. Another term for this would be an Oligarchy, control by a few companies who enforce predatory and aggressive terms.....
